Luis Echegaray

39%
Flag icon
Budget 20% of time for generic sustaining engineering work across the board By “generic sustaining engineering work,” I mean testing, debugging, cleaning up legacy code, migrating language or platform versions, and doing other work that has to happen. If you make this a habit, you can use it to tackle some of the midsize legacy code every quarter and get decent improvements. Cleaning up systems as you go keeps those systems easy to work in, which keeps your teams moving forward on new features. In the worst case, you can use this slack to smooth over unexpected delays in feature development, ...more
The Manager's Path: A Guide for Tech Leaders Navigating Growth and Change
Rate this book
Clear rating
Open Preview